Celebrating the Remarkable Talents of Jeffrey Combs: A Look at Three Standout Performances


Jeffrey Combs, the seasoned actor known for his versatility and captivating on-screen presence, has left an indelible mark on the world of horror and science fiction. With a career spanning over four decades, Combs has portrayed a range of memorable characters, captivating audiences with his exceptional talent. In this article, we delve into three standout performances from the prolific actor and also bring exciting news for fans: Jeffrey Combs will be gracing the Sinister Creature Con in Sacramento this Father's Day weekend!


Herbert West in "Re-Animator" (1985): One cannot discuss Jeffrey Combs without mentioning his iconic role as Herbert West in Stuart Gordon's cult classic, "Re-Animator." Combs delivered a mesmerizing performance as the eccentric and morally ambiguous scientist, injecting the character with a perfect blend of intelligence, dark humor, and madness. His portrayal of West showcased his ability to seamlessly balance the line between horror and comedy, earning him a dedicated fan following and solidifying his status as a genre favorite.



Edgar Allan Poe in "The Black Cat" (2007): In the Masters of Horror anthology series episode "The Black Cat," Jeffrey Combs tackled the complex task of embodying one of literature's most renowned figures, Edgar Allan Poe. With his impeccable attention to detail and deep understanding of Poe's tormented psyche, Combs breathed life into the troubled writer, capturing his essence with haunting precision. His performance showcased his ability to bring depth and humanity to historical characters, leaving a lasting impression on viewers.



Weyoun in "Star Trek: Deep Space Nine" (1994-1999): Jeffrey Combs's contribution to the "Star Trek" franchise cannot be overlooked, particularly his portrayal of Weyoun, the enigmatic and manipulative Vorta diplomat. Across multiple seasons of "Star Trek: Deep Space Nine," Combs brought a distinct charm and chilling charisma to the character, making Weyoun one of the most memorable recurring villains in the series. Combs's nuanced performance allowed him to navigate the complexities of Weyoun's loyalty to the Dominion while retaining a sense of his own individuality.
